Write characteristics(in points) of cold weather season.
Asked by vatsalchoudhary41 | 04 Nov, 2014, 06:08: AM
Important characteristics of cols weather season in India are:
The cold weather season in India begins during mid November in Northern India and stays till February. December and January are the coldest months.
During the cold season, the days are warm and nights are cold.
When temperature decreases, frost is commonly experienced in Northern India
The cold season in most parts of the country is the dry season as northeast trade winds blow from land to sea.
Many cyclonic disturbances occur over northern India during this time. These results in rainfall during winters and snow fall in the Himalayan regions. This winter rainfall helps in the cultivation of the rabi crops.
